What does data sovereignty mean?

Data sovereignty means having unrestricted control over your own data. This encompasses who is permitted to access the data, where it is stored and how it is used. At its core, it is about ensuring that data is processed and protected in accordance with your own requirements — particularly at a time when digital data is becoming ever more valuable.

In a globalised world where data is transferred and stored across national borders, the question of data sovereignty is growing increasingly complex. This is because data is subject to the laws and regulations of the country in which it is stored, making data sovereignty a critically important consideration in international business.

How does cloud computing affect data sovereignty?

Cloud computing offers many advantages, but also introduces challenges for data sovereignty. When data is moved to the cloud, organisations often lose direct control over where it is stored and how it is processed. This can create difficulties, particularly when data is stored in countries whose data protection standards are less stringent than those of the EU.

Using cloud services such as Microsoft Azure therefore requires a careful assessment of the associated risks and benefits. Organisations must ensure that their data is stored and protected in accordance with local regulations. Data localisation plays an important role here, as it ensures that data remains within defined geographical boundaries — thereby strengthening control over data sovereignty.

 

Data sovereignty and data localisation: What does this mean for your organisation?

Data sovereignty and data localisation are closely related concepts that work together to strengthen control over data. Data sovereignty refers to the ability of a country or organisation to retain full control over the storage and processing of its data. Data localisation, by contrast, requires that data be stored within a specific geographical area in order to remain subject to local laws and regulations.

For organisations, this means carefully considering where their data is stored to ensure that data sovereignty is maintained. Storing data outside the EU can have legal implications, as it may then fall under different laws and regulatory frameworks.

What legal frameworks apply to data sovereignty?

The legal frameworks governing data sovereignty vary depending on the jurisdiction and the type of data involved. Within the EU, the GDPR is the primary legislation protecting data sovereignty. However, other laws — such as the US CLOUD Act — also affect data sovereignty, as they regulate access to data stored in the cloud.

Organisations must therefore ensure that they are familiar with and comply with the relevant legal frameworks in order to maintain their data sovereignty. This can be achieved through contractual agreements with cloud providers and through the implementation of confidentiality measures that guarantee the protection of data.

How to protect your data sovereignty contractually

One of the most important steps organisations can take to maintain data sovereignty is to put appropriate contractual protections in place. Through data licensing agreements and other contractual arrangements, organisations can ensure that their data is only used and stored under defined conditions. These agreements should clearly set out what usage rights are granted to the service provider and how data security will be guaranteed.

It is also important for organisations to specify in their contracts that data sovereignty remains with them and that they retain full control over access to their data. This can be achieved through clear provisions on data localisation and compliance with local regulations.
